Does State Farm homeowners insurance cover broken pipes?

Yes, State Farm homeowners insurance typically covers damage caused by broken pipes in your home. However, the coverage may vary depending on the specifics of your policy.

Broken pipes can cause significant damage to your home, leading to water damage, mold growth, and structural issues. This is why it’s essential to know what your insurance policy covers in the event of a pipe break.

1. Will State Farm cover the cost of repairing broken pipes?

Yes, State Farm homeowners insurance will likely cover the cost of repairing broken pipes in your home. However, the coverage may be subject to your policy’s deductible and limits.

2. Does State Farm cover damage caused by a pipe burst?

Yes, State Farm insurance typically covers damage caused by a burst pipe, including water damage and necessary repairs. However, exclusions may apply depending on the specifics of your policy.

3. What steps should I take if I have a broken pipe in my home?

If you have a broken pipe in your home, it’s essential to turn off the water supply to prevent further damage. Then, contact your insurance provider, like State Farm, to make a claim and schedule repairs.

4. Will State Farm cover the cost of water damage caused by a broken pipe?

Yes, State Farm homeowners insurance will likely cover the cost of water damage caused by a broken pipe, including the cost of drying out the affected area and repairing any resulting damage.

5. Does State Farm cover the cost of replacing personal belongings damaged by a broken pipe?

State Farm homeowners insurance may cover the cost of replacing personal belongings damaged by a broken pipe, up to the limits of your policy. It’s essential to document the damage and provide evidence to support your claim.

6. Are there any exclusions for broken pipe damage in State Farm homeowners insurance?

While State Farm homeowners insurance typically covers damage caused by broken pipes, there may be exclusions based on the cause of the pipe break or the age of the plumbing system. Review your policy details for specific exclusions.

7. Does State Farm offer any additional coverage options for broken pipes?

State Farm may offer additional coverage options, such as water backup coverage or service line coverage, to further protect your home from damage caused by broken pipes. Contact your agent to discuss these options.

8. Will State Farm cover the cost of temporary accommodations if my home is unlivable due to a broken pipe?

If your home is unlivable due to damage from a broken pipe, State Farm homeowners insurance may cover the cost of temporary accommodations while your home is being repaired. Check your policy for details on this coverage.

9. Can I prevent broken pipes from being covered by my State Farm insurance?

Intentional damage or neglect that leads to broken pipes may not be covered by State Farm homeowners insurance. It’s essential to properly maintain your plumbing system to prevent avoidable pipe breaks.

10. Are there any specific requirements for filing a claim for broken pipe damage with State Farm?

When filing a claim for broken pipe damage with State Farm, it’s important to provide as much information as possible, including photos of the damage, receipts for repairs, and documentation of the event leading to the pipe break.

11. Does State Farm offer assistance with finding reputable contractors to repair broken pipes?

State Farm may offer assistance with finding reputable contractors to repair broken pipes in your home. Your agent can provide recommendations or resources to help you find qualified professionals.

12. How can I ensure that my State Farm homeowners insurance policy adequately covers damage from broken pipes?

To ensure that your State Farm homeowners insurance policy adequately covers damage from broken pipes, review your policy details regularly and consider adding additional coverage options if necessary. Keep your agent informed of any changes to your home that may impact your coverage needs.
